Frogs are amphibians known for their jumping abilities, bulging eyes and slimy skin.  They also have a very unique croaking sound.  They live all over the world around bodies of fresh water as they need them to reproduce.  Frogs eat any living thing that fits in their mouths.  Fossils of frogs have been found dating back to 265 million years ago.  Their slimy skin produce secretions that range from distasteful to toxic.  Frogs can, during extreme conditions, enter a state of dormancy called a Torpor and remain inactive for months buried underground.  My frogs are on the threatened or endangered lists.  Frogs have been featured in religion, folklore and popular culture.
